Typed letter signed by WWII General Douglas MacArthur in 1955. Letter, dated 10 February 1955, was sent from MacArthur's home in New York to the Fehr family, and reads in full; ''Dear Friends: Thank you so much for your birthday greeting. I appreciate it deeply. It made my day a brighter one, indeed.'' MacArthur signs ''Most cordially / Douglas MacArthur'' in black ink. Measures 8'' x 10''. Very good with one mailing fold.
